When Betty and Billy rescued Walter from the pound, they never imagined that such a cute dog could fart so much. But just when the dog seems destined to be returned to the pound, a remarkable event turns him into a hero, and his new family learns to live with his smells. Full-color illustrations.
Walter is banished to a lifeboat traveling behind an ocean liner because of his powerful farts. When the liner loses power, the great cruise ship, its frightened passengers--and Walter--are marooned on the high seas. Full color.
Walter saves the day once again in this high-flying exploit, now in paperback. Professor Kompressor visits and offers a remedy for Walters digestive disorder. Unfortunately, his cure doesn't work, so Father takes matters into his own hands. Full color.
